Check Digit Verification of cas no

The CAS Registry Mumber 1258876-11-7 includes 10 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 7 digits, 1,2,5,8,8,7 and 6 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 1 and 1 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 1258876-11:
(9*1)+(8*2)+(7*5)+(6*8)+(5*8)+(4*7)+(3*6)+(2*1)+(1*1)=197
197 % 10 = 7
So 1258876-11-7 is a valid CAS Registry Number.

Synthesis of 2-isoxazolines: Enantioselective and racemic methods based on conjugate additions of oximes

Pohjakallio, Antti,Pihko, Petri M.,Laitinen, Ulla M.

scheme or table, p. 11325 - 11339 (2010/11/16)

The formation of 3-unsubstituted 2-isoxazolines by means of condensation reactions between α,β-unsaturated aldehydes and oximes proceeds readily in the presence of catalytic amounts of anilinium salts. Mechanistically, the process involves a fast conjugate addition of the oxime and a slower intramolecular oxime-transfer reaction. The rate of oxime transfer was found to correlate with the acidity of the catalyst. This finding enabled us to discover an enantioselective process in which the fragile conjugate-addition product generated in the first stage is rapidly cyclized into the stable isoxazo-line under acidic conditions, with conservation of enantiomeric excess. In summary, herein we describe synthetically useful protocols for accessing 3-unsubstituted 2-isoxazolines in both the enantioselective and racemic manner. The mechanism of the condensation reaction catalyzed by the anilinium salt was also investigated by NMR spectroscopy experiments in which the effect of differently substituted aldehydes and oximes as well as water on the reaction rate was studied. The results point to the rate-limiting elimination of water from the 3-hydroxy-2-iso-xazolidine intermediate.
